Sorry if this was already covered in another thread... I did a search and looked around for a while / on google but didn't seem to find anything.
I'm using a T60p and I never had this problem before today. Whenever I plug or unplug the AC power the screen flashes blank and then comes back on...
Before it used to just dim itself when on AC power without the flash refresh. The only change that I've made is in the BIOS, where I set display brightness to "High" for maximum brightness while unplugged. I tried switching this back to "Normal" but I have the same problem still, it will flicker the screen then dim itself down...
Anyone encounter this problem or know how to fix it?

I've never heard of this problem.
Try this: go into the BIOS and try removing and plugging in wall power. Does the screen flash there? If not, then it may be relayed to the software switching power plans, and not the hardware.
What OS are you running? Vista, perhaps?

I'm currently running XP SP2 32bit. I never had this problem before prior to install some updates via System Update.
I've already tried remove all the software that it had installed most recently including Power Manager and I still get the same problem.
The problem also seems to cut out sound for a flash along with the screen. I am 100% sure it is software related as it doesn't happen in BIOS or during Windows Shutdown/Restart. But if not Power Manager I'm not sure what other program would affect it...
